摘要

针对现有视线估计方法存在的主要问题:限制使用者头部运动和个体标定问题,本文提出一种基于立体视觉的视线估计方法.建立了一种双相机双光源条件下计算眼睛光轴的five-spot模型,本模型估计眼球光轴三维方向只需要一次直线求交运算.以此为基础形成一种新的视线估计方法,本方法实现了自然头动视线估计,并且简化用户标定为单点标定.该方法的各个环节都满足实时性要求,为面向人机交互的视线追踪系统提供了有效的解决方案.

Abstract

For main problems of the existing gaze estimation methods which are that they restrict the head movement of users and the issue of individual calibration,this paper presents a gaze estimation method based on stereo vision.A five-spot model for the eye optical axis on the condition of two cameras and two light sources is set up.The model estimates the threedimensional orientation of the eye optical axis,which only needs one straightline intersection operation.On this basis,we forms a new gaze estimation method.This method allows natural head movement and minimizes the calibration procedure to only one time for a new individual.All aspects of this method meet the real-time requirement,which provides an effective solution for human-computer interaction gaze tracking system.
